the first 2 weeks of my ss i had a little sneeky milk in my coffee to ease myself into the programme, then i cut it right out from week 3 and 4 and my loss has slowed down. just wondering if it is coincidental?
 
I believe that your weight loss does slow down after the initial couple of weeks anyway, obviously we can't sustain big losses each week.
 
Yes, it's unlikely to be because of the milk.

The first two weeks weightloss will include water loss, so tends to be much faster. It then settles down whilst it burns fat.

Week 3 is often a slower week compared to week 4 onwards. Not always the case, but I usually warn my clients that this may happen and to chug on through it as it often picks up again in week 4 :)
